CCL Group Stage Awaits Toronto
Ryan Johnson scored two goals and Toronto FC’s defense did the rest on Tuesday night, as the Reds topped Real Estelí F.C. 2-1 in the second game of the teams’ CONCACAF Champions League preliminary round series in Estelí, Nicaragua to advance to the tournament’s group stage.

Johnson scored on a gorgeous strike from distance in the 37th minute and then buried a breakaway chance after Real Estelí goalkeeper Carlos Mendieta muffed a clearance in the 47th minute to help TFC lock down a 4-2 series win on aggregate goals. The Reds won the two-game series opener 2-1 last week at BMO Field.

The win was Toronto’s first ever on the road in CCL play, and good enough to launch them into Group C when play opens later this month. TFC join a group with Mexican side Pumas, Panamanian group Tauro and the winner of FC Dallas and El Salvador’s Alianza FC. FC Dallas boast a 1-0 lead heading into the series finale on Wednesday night at Pizza Hut Park.
